ATLANTA – March 7, 2019 — Brightree® today announced a new pharmacy suite for home infusion therapy providers and home medical equipment (HME) pharmacies to help them optimize business processes, more easily meet compliance requirements and provide the highest quality patient care.

Pharmacy suite features

Brightree’s all-in-one suite brings automation to every step of the home infusion and HME pharmacy work flow, starting with its ePrescribe capabilities, which creates a seamless connection with leading electronic health/medical records (EHR/EMR) and third-party vendors to receive necessary patient data and process medication prescriptions electronically. Once the order is received, staff can use Brightree’s platform to obtain and document insurance authorization; conduct clinical monitoring, including assessing the patient’s fit for home infusion and creating a care plan to monitor therapy; fill pharmacy orders; deliver medication, supplies and equipment to the patient; conduct billing and collections; and then coordinate with Accounts Receivable management and reporting. The comprehensive solution also includes:

  • Care Plans, which enable providers to establish and customize plans of care and help them comply with accreditation requirements.
  • Test Claims, which enable reimbursement assessments before patient referrals are accepted or products are delivered.
  • Patient engagement with the Patient Hub app, allows providers to consolidate all patient interactions into one automated platform, giving them the time and tools needed to take care of patients, and increase revenue.
